JPEG压缩标准详解:变换系数量化与编码

需积分: 9 2 下载量 20 浏览量 更新于2024-08-21 收藏 365KB PPT 举报
"JPEG是一种广泛使用的图像压缩标准,它采用了变换编码技术,特别是离散余弦变换(DCT)。变换编码的思想是通过正交变换将图像数据从时域转换到频域,以突出图像的主要特征并简化量化和编码过程。在这个过程中,量化是一个关键步骤,它将变换系数按照一定的规则进行取整,以减少数据量。在JPEG中,对于不同的DCT系数,使用了不同的量化矩阵Q(u,v),使得低频系数(对应图像的主要结构)的量化步长较小,高频系数(对应图像的细节和噪声)的量化步长较大。这样可以保留图像的基本结构,同时丢弃对视觉影响较小的高频信息,从而实现高效压缩。" 在JPEG标准中,变换编码主要包括以下几个方面: 1. **离散余弦变换(DCT)**:DCT是一种正交变换,它可以将图像数据转换成频域表示。在DCT中,图像被划分为8x8的块,每个块都独立进行变换。DCT的结果是8x8的系数矩阵,其中低频系数(靠近中心的系数)反映了图像的整体结构,高频系数则包含图像的细节。 2. **量化**:DCT系数经过量化后,数值变为整数,这是为了适应二进制编码的需求。量化矩阵Q(u,v)是根据心理视觉模型设计的,对低频系数应用较小的量化步长,高频系数应用较大的量化步长,以减少编码后的位数,同时尽可能保持图像质量。 3. **编码**:量化后的系数通常是非均匀分布的,大部分是零或接近零,这可以通过熵编码(如霍夫曼编码或算术编码)进一步压缩,因为编码零值或出现频率高的值所需的信息量较少。 4. **正交变换的性质**:正交变换保证了信息的无损恢复,只要量化过程不引入过多的失真。在JPEG中,DCT矩阵是一个正交矩阵,它的逆变换也是其自身,这确保了在解码时能够准确还原原始数据。 5. **压缩效率**:JPEG通过变换、量化和编码的组合,能够在保留图像基本视觉效果的同时,大幅度减少数据量,从而实现高效的图像压缩。 6. **视觉感知**:JPEG算法考虑了人类视觉系统的特性,对人眼不太敏感的高频信息进行更大幅度的压缩,以达到更高的压缩比,而不会显著影响图像的视觉质量。 JPEG通过DCT变换和精心设计的量化策略,实现了在压缩图像数据的同时,尽可能保持了图像的质量,使其成为数字图像处理领域的一个重要标准。